In CP and CTF: If the other team isn't present, flags are made and CP started. At the end of 15 minutes, how is the winner determined? The flags and CP points aren't counted if the other team isn't there. 

 

Say, Blue makes 3 flags before Red team is formed. During the battle, Red makes 4 flags and Blue makes 3 more. No more flags are made. End score: Blue--6 and Red--4. But three of Blue's flags were made before Red showed. So, regardless of the score of 6 to 4, Blue's favor, isn't Red declared the winner and gets the bulk of the crystals?

 

----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

 

Same with CP. If Blue team captures all the CP's before Red shows up, those points aren't suppose to count. However, the cp's goes back and forth throughout the battle and you know it's a close game, but Blue wins by a small margin. How is that determined if they already have the CPs before Red shows. Does Red have to play catch-up to make up for those points Blue already has and then dominate the game to win? 

 

For example: If Blue already has 25 points before Red team starts forming, does Red have to make up those 25 points to break even and then make the majority of 75 to win? OR does the count actually start after the first member of Red appears? 

 

I guess to determine who is actually winning during the battle, then you have to subtract 25 points from Blue's score and keep track that way. Right?

No matter how many flags or CP points you capture regardless of whether they are enemies in the other team or not, it will be counted but if there are no players on the enemy team, it only makes sense not to get any score from these captured flags or CP points. But if there was a players on the enemy team, you will get score from them. If the Blue team captures 30 flags/points without the present of the other team and new players start joining the red team, what will be determinated is how the battle will end, red team obviously have to capture 30 flags first to make it tie so yea, they have to catch up if they are going for the win and they can't just say 30 flags/points has already been captured and we were't here so those 30 flags/points has nothing to do with us and the game is now 0-0 for both teams.

A few weeks ago, I had my eye on a battle from the lobby. There were 2 on Red and none on Blue. From the lobby, I could see they were capturing the flag without opposition (no one on Blue). They were up to 9 flags. Someone joined Red. Immediately, the 10th flag was made (obviously someone was sitting near the team flag holding the enemy flag) ending the battle. The one that made the 10th flag was the one who got the capture point.

 

What a way to accomplish a mission. In just a matter of one second, he was first in battle and captured one flag....knocking off 2 missions at the same time without any effort at all. Sounds like this whole thing was planned right from the beginning, including the Red player joining so late.

That could be the case or maybe just not. Sometimes, it might be planned among friends to ditch some of the annoying missions we all don't like or at least for me such as being first in battle(s) but other times, it can also be a random thing such as players fleeing from the battle because of how powerful the enemy team is/became hence not wasting any of their precious time in a battle that they all know they won't be winning at all. 

 

It can also be because some Clan's like to join battles together as a team so they look some empty battles where the enemy team is dominating and try to take-over such battles. So here is how some players take advantage of suck battles by doing just the exact same thing you mentioned up there which is leaving 1 point or flag and waiting the enemy team to be full of players. So if a Clan tries to take over the battle, the player who had the flag can easily just capture the remaining flag and end the battle right when the first player joins the battle, won't even be waiting the rest of the Clan members since he/she doesn't wana take any risks at all which is killing 2 birds with one stone, Won the battle and he/she was first without any efforts at all.
